Types of Brushes for Cleaning Pet Hair
When it comes to cleaning pet hair, there are several types of brushes available in the market. The most common types include slicker brushes, pin brushes, bristle brushes, and rubber brushes. Slicker brushes are ideal for removing tangles and mats from pet hair, while pin brushes are better suited for pets with sensitive skin. Bristle brushes are great for removing loose hair and distributing natural oils throughout the coat, and rubber brushes are perfect for removing hair from furniture and clothing.
Each type of brush has its own unique features and benefits, and the right brush for the job will depend on the type of pet hair you are dealing with. For example, if you have a pet with long, curly hair, a slicker brush may be the best option. On the other hand, if you have a pet with short, smooth hair, a bristle brush may be a better choice.
In addition to these types of brushes, there are also combination brushes that combine the features of multiple brush types. These brushes are great for pets with complex coat types, or for pet owners who want a single brush that can handle all their pet hair cleaning needs. Tips for Effectively Using Brushes for Cleaning Pet Hair
To get the most out of your brush and keep your pet’s coat clean and healthy, there are a few tips to keep in mind. The first tip is to brush your pet regularly, ideally once or twice a day. This will help remove loose hair and prevent mats and tangles from forming. You should also brush your pet in the direction of the hair growth, rather than against it, as this can cause breakage and tangles.
Another tip is to be gentle when brushing your pet, especially if they have sensitive skin. Start with short sessions and gradually increase the duration as your pet becomes more comfortable with the brushing process. You should also avoid brushing too hard, as this can cause discomfort and even pain. Additionally, consider brushing your pet after bathing, as this can help remove tangles and mats that form when the coat is wet.
When using a brush to clean pet hair from furniture and clothing, there are a few tips to keep in mind. The first tip is to use a brush specifically designed for this purpose, as these brushes are typically made with rubber or other materials that are gentle on surfaces. You should also use a gentle touch, as rough brushing can damage fabrics and surfaces. Additionally, consider using a lint roller or tape to remove loose hair, as these can be more effective than brushing alone.

How do I clean and maintain a brush designed for pet hair, to ensure it continues to effectively remove hair and last a long time?
To clean and maintain a brush designed for pet hair, start by removing any loose hair or debris from the brush using your fingers or a comb. Then, wash the brush with mild soap and warm water, being sure to rinse it thoroughly to remove any soap residue. You can also soak the brush in a mixture of equal parts water and white vinegar to help remove any stubborn hair or dirt.
To dry the brush, simply shake it out and allow it to air dry. You can also use a towel to gently pat the brush dry, being sure not to rub or scrub the bristles, which can cause damage. By cleaning and maintaining your brush regularly, you can help to ensure that it continues to effectively remove pet hair and lasts a long time. It’s also a good idea to store the brush in a dry place, away from direct sunlight, to help prevent damage and extend its lifespan.
